Subject: Supplier Contract Renewal — Velloric Components

Team, the Velloric supply agreement expires at quarter-end. Pricing terms are broadly unchanged; the volume commitment rises 4%. Legal has cleared the draft, and procurement recommends a two-year term. For our incoming director, Hale Morwen, this is the key open contract to review first. Relevant context on our plans is appended confidentially below.

board note of hahaf-fahog: The pricing group signed off on a budget of $229.3 million for Project Aldius.

## Deploying the Gatewick Proctor Queue

Deploys are pretty painless: push to main, wait for the pipeline, then watch the queue drain dashboard for five minutes. If candidates pile up mid-exam, roll back first and ask questions later — the queue replays safely. Everything the workers care about lives in one config block, shown here for reference.

settings of bafof-yagef:
JOROX_PIN=8740
JOROX_TENANT=pelox
JOROX_METRICS_HOST=metrics.jorox.qorvelworks.internal
JOROX_SEAL=seal_c78f63c1
JOROX_STANDBY_TEAM=norax

The registry caches resolved schemas
 * locally and refreshes them in the background; unknown schema IDs trigger a
 * synchronous fetch with a bounded timeout, after which the event is rejected.
 * Compatibility checks run on registration, not on publish, so breaking
 * changes fail fast. Do not override these values per-plugin; they are tuned
 * for the shared broker tier. The cache and fetch behavior is controlled by
 * the constants below.
 */

tuning table, kajog-bawip:
TIERS = {
    "kelius": 256,
    "lammir": 543,
}

Subject: Carvela unit sale — where things stand

Team, quick update before Thursday. We've signed the term sheet to sell the Carvela logistics unit to Pendrith Partners. Finance, please start carving out the unit's P&L and intercompany balances — diligence kicks off in two weeks. Headcount questions go through Marta only; nothing to staff yet, please. It's a clean deal, decent multiple, minimal earn-out. Broader context is in the confidential note below.

internal memo for kawip-hadug: Headcount on the Wenwyn team goes from 7 to 140 by the end of January. Gross margin on Wenwyn came in at 20 percent against a plan of 15 percent.